Giannini, Kenneth
Age 79
Of Maplewood
June 22, 1946 - Feb. 17, 2026
Kenneth Anthony Giannini passed away in the early morning of Feb. 17 in the company of those he loved.
Ken was an avid East-Sider, graduating from Hill High School and haunting the streets of the Hayden Heights neighborhood as a young man. After working as a cub reporter and photographer for the Pioneer Press, he proudly served in the U.S. Army during the Vietnam War.
In the late ’70s, he began his long career at the Minnesota State Fair while also completing his B.A. in Journalism at the University of St. Thomas. He worked in Publicity and Marketing during his 25-plus years at the State Fair, culminating in a role with the fair’s foundation and receiving his 50-Year Award for a lifetime of fair activity.
Ken loved to be with people, whether on the golf course, at family gatherings with all of his favorite cousins, or at the North St. Paul American Legion where he served on the board during his retirement. The person he most loved to be with, though, was his grandson Connor. Nothing in the world brought him more joy than his time with Connor.
He was preceded in death by his mother Mary “Minnie” and father Henry “Hank”. He is survived by sons Mark (Becky) and Tony (Tracy); beloved grandson Connor; brother Henry Jr. “Skip” (Joanne); and nephews Mike (Cari), Joe (Mary) and John (Gracie).
